Voyant Photonics is redefining machine perception with compact, high-performance LiDAR devices that fit in the palm of your hand. Leveraging cutting-edge silicon photonic chips, our sensors deliver unparalleled accuracy in range, velocity, and reflectivity, at a fraction of the cost of traditional LiDAR systems. By transforming high-precision sensing into an accessible technology, we are enabling new applications in robotics, autonomous systems, industrial automation, and beyond.
